As General Manager, you are responsible for leading your Senior Management team to deliver and perform against plan.
you'll do this through leading, coaching and inspiring your depot management team for optimum results. Leadership through dynamic engagement and communication with all colleagues is essential to ensure you are able to flex and react quickly to change. You'll love growing talent and raising the performance bar to ensure you have a top team, helping everyone save money, live better
You will be leading, coaching and motivating the Leadership team and your colleagues to deliver the optimum plan for the site. You will look to drive continuous improvement where possible, to help deliver against the plan and your P&L.
You'll have strong leadership behaviours and the ability to flex and react quickly within an ever-changing environment.
You'll drive performance and work cross-functionally, communicating effectively across all levels.
